Quote:
Originally Posted by insomniac
ah.. well i wholeheartedly agree.
Thanks

Edit: another question.. what settings do you save a .dss file as? (using the nvida plugin) everyone i've tried crashes the game/doesn't work/explodes into a rainbow of colors

Try opening with NO MIP Mapping then save

DXT5 ARGB (Interpolated Alpha)
Generate MIP Maps

cool thanks. Also something to note if you're making you own .dss file, the dimensions have to be a power of 2

DXT3, DXT5 and 32bit ARGB have all worked fine for me. Either DXT3 or DXT5 are the format the stock interface seems to use.
